I used to run scalepack2mtz succefully. now it is not working. Can anybody 
suggest the way to short it out.

%chmod +x scalepack2mtz.exam   (% is a unix/linux prompt).
%scalepack2mtz.exam

message is as follows.
bash: scalepack2mtz.exam: command not found

Although I sourced the path /opt/ccp4/ccp4-6.0/ccp4-6.0/bin , I still get the 
same message.

It depends on your path environment variable... It used to be that . 
was by default in your path - then the more security conscious removed 
the current working directory from the default list of paths to search 
for commands.


Try ./scalepack2mtz.exam 
The ./ gives a path
